Chapter 140: The Aftermath of the House Raid
But such a large amount of money is already jaw-dropping. It can be considered a huge sum of money!
Everyone couldn't help but feel suspicious, and it made people more certain that Village Chief Zhao was corrupt.
The village chief’s son and daughter have never sent any money back, so how come their family has so much savings?
Zhao Guiquan’s salary can’t be that high.
Although Secretary Zhao embezzled the resettlement fee for educated youth, he still bought houses for his children in the city!
As for Zhao Guixiang, she only worked a few days a year during the busy farming season, doing easy work with low work points, but she actually managed to save more than 500 yuan.
Not to mention the betrothal gift given by the husband's family, other male educated youth who got married in the countryside, if their families were better off, would just give a little as a token of their appreciation.
He Junwei usually looks like a decent person, but he only gave 20 yuan for his marriage. His parents didn't even write a letter. The house he lives in was built with money from the village chief's family.
In the end, Wang Lanhua and Zhao Guixiang were both taken away.
Only a group of stunned people and Zhao Guixiang's one-year-old son were left.
These people didn't smash anything and didn't take anything away except money.
After everyone left, many people wanted to go into the house and take advantage of the situation.
The team leader and Accountant Li walked out of the crowd, stopped these people, and locked all the doors of the Zhao family.
We don’t know what the outcome will be now. If we take away all their food, how will their families survive?
After locking all the doors of the Zhao family's house, the team leader asked Accountant Li in surprise, "Do the educated youth from the Imperial Capital and the Magic City really receive 400 yuan each for resettlement?"
Accountant Li had a similar expression and said unhappily, "How should I know? It's always Zhao who collects the money, and I'm responsible for registering what he brings back. He used to always get 125, but last year they said some were distributed to educated youth, so there's only 90 left."
Although Accountant Li is an accountant, he is only responsible for the village accounts. Village Chief Zhao is responsible for reporting to the commune.
As for how the village chief reported it, I don’t know.
Li Hehua interjected, "Earlier, Jiang Zhiqing said she had two hundred yuan in subsidies from the Zhiqing Office. You didn't believe it, but now you can ask and find out."
The captain called Lin Shaoyang over and asked, "You used to have 400 resettlement allowances."
Lin Shaoyang spoke frankly, "It used to be 400, and the Ministry of Finance sent it directly to the local government, including our first year's rations, money for farm tools, and accommodation. Last year, it seemed that only 200 was paid, mainly for farm tools and accommodation. 200 was directly given to the educated youth. I know that the cities that received 400 are the Imperial Capital, Jiudu, Modu, Pingdu, Jindu, and Sucheng. As for the provincial capital and other places, it seems to be 125. Now, 35 goes to the educated youth, and only 90 goes to the local treasury."
Accountant Li said, "They're reporting the resettlement fees from the big city to the village based on the standards of a small place."
Accountant Li and the team leader finally understood why Village Chief Zhao liked to bring back so many educated youth.
If you can bring one back, you can earn so much money. Who wouldn’t want to bring one back?
They not only embezzled the living expenses, but also made the educated youth pay for the food in their village themselves.
Some people also asked curiously: "Why are resettlement fees in big cities higher than in small places?"
Accountant Li was clear on this point: "Why don't you ask why there are fewer returnees from big cities than from small cities? Up to now, there haven't been any job openings from big cities for educated youth in our brigade. Those who have been able to return have done so because their families have found ways to get them back. That 400 yuan isn't resettlement money; it's a subsidy for canceling your big city hukou."
Everyone started discussing it, seemingly understanding it or not!
In the afternoon, everyone stopped working and gathered together to calculate how much money Village Chief Zhao had embezzled in the village over the years.
The calculation directly resulted in a huge sum of money. Everyone thought that Village Chief Zhao had accomplices in the commune, otherwise he would not be so powerful.
We don’t know exactly how much Secretary Zhao embezzled, but it must have been a lot.
The more they calculated, the angrier they became. If it weren't for the team leader and Accountant Li suppressing them, some of these furious people would have wanted to tear down Village Chief Zhao's house!
Mother Li dragged the trembling Li Ying back home and said, "What are you afraid of? You've already severed ties. It won't harm you. I'll ask your eldest brother to go to the commune to find Zhao Guiquan and tell him to tell you that we've severed ties."
Li Ying burst into tears, sobbing and complaining, "Mom, I'm so upset. Zhao Guiquan has been married to me for more than five years, and he has paid 30 yuan to the family every month. That's 360 yuan a year, and at least 1,800 yuan in five years. But only 700 yuan was found with Wang Lanhua. Where did the rest go? Zhao Guixiang does nothing, but she still gives He Junwei living expenses every month. Now she actually has more than 500 yuan in savings. Where did all that money come from? This is all Zhao Guiquan's salary. She said every day that she would keep the money for us, afraid that I would use it to support my parents, but in the end she used it all to support her other children."
Mother Li said with a look of dismay, "What's the point of you crying now? I told you to stand up straight, but you didn't listen. You still think they don't want you when you're not around. You're really afraid that we'll really ask for your money. I don't know how I could have given birth to such a clueless person like you."
Li Ying cried even harder after being scolded. Her mother sighed and said, "Don't cry. It doesn't matter if you lose your job or your money. In the countryside, as long as you work hard, you won't starve. What you need to do now is to prevent Zhao Guiquan from getting implicated. Think about the two children too. With a grandfather like this, if Zhao Guiquan gets implicated again, they won't be able to hold their heads up high for the rest of their lives."
I really don't know why I gave birth to such a stupid thing.
Li Ying also came to her senses and said, "Mom, please help me look after the child. My brother and I will go to the commune to take a look."
After Li Ying left, the team leader and Accountant Li brought Zhao Guixiang's son over and asked Li Ying to take care of him for a few days.
Li's mother was not happy about this, so she took the opportunity to tell her the reason why Zhao Guiquan broke off relations with his family.
She also recounted how Wang Lanhua had abused her daughter over the years.
My son-in-law earns more than 30 yuan a month, and he only needs five yuan for living expenses.
Every penny of the five dollars had to be reported clearly to Wang Lanhua. If there was even a penny missing, she would say it was used to subsidize the Li family.
However, Wang Lanhua used her son-in-law's salary to subsidize her other children.
It was obvious that the money in Wang Lanhua's hands was Zhao Guiquan's salary.
The team leader and Accountant Li didn't know what to say. Everyone in the village knew that Wang Lanhua was torturing her young daughter-in-law.
Moreover, Li Ying married into the Zhao family under such circumstances, which was considered shameful in the village.
After so many years, this is probably the only case in the entire commune. No family is willing to marry a girl like this.
Now even Zhao Guiquan has come to live with his mother-in-law, which means that they have become incompatible.
The relationship between the two families was already not good, and now that the Zhao family has encountered this kind of incident, who would be willing to accept another child? It might bring trouble upon themselves.
In the end, the team leader and his two companions sent the child to the home of Village Chief Zhao’s younger brother, but the brother said that the two families had not had any contact for many years.
Now that something has happened, I am afraid of being implicated and am even less likely to help take care of the children.
There was no choice but for the child to be taken back by the team leader.
